One of the most popular types of tourism in Indonesia is marine tourism. The reason is, the number of marine resources is abundant so that it can be used as a tourist area. For example, Bunaken National Park is a marine park with the advantages of extraordinary natural charm. Located in the North Sulawesi region, Bunaken National Park is still very natural.
Bunaken is a national park that the Minister of Forestry has designated in 1991 as a tourist attraction, which has a location that is representative of Indonesia’s tropical aquatic ecosystem. Bunaken consists of ecosystems of mangrove forests, seagrass beds, coral reefs, and terrestrial or coastal ecosystems. Bunaken National Park has 13 genera or genera of living corals with fringing reefs and barrier reefs. In addition, there are about 91 types of fish that live in these waters, such as gusumi horse fish, ranging from yellowtail.
Those who come to enjoy Bunaken underwater tourism are also from local tourists and abroad or foreign tourists. This proves that tourism in Indonesia does have a world appeal. Many marine tourism activities can be done in this place, such as diving, snorkeling, sunbathing, and swimming. There is also a diving center called Dragonet, which was once the secretariat of the Sail Bunaken event. Located on Kalase beach, precisely on the outskirts of Manado, Sail Bunaken broke the MURI record with more than 2000 divers who participated in the flag ceremony on the seabed.
The Attractions of Bunaken Marine Park
Many are curious, why is Bunaken called heaven on earth? The answer is because divers can find about 20 diving spots. Twelve diving spots can be found on the island of Bunaken itself. Even the uniqueness of the dives here is the visibility that can reach 20 meters. That means the condition of the water is so clear. Even at certain times, the visibility of this area can indeed reach less than 35 meters.
In addition, there is also a giant coral wall that is curved and vertical, which serves to feed the small fish in the sea. The visitors can, of course see an extraordinary beauty.

- Play While Learning
Bunaken National Park can be used as a study tour destination for teenagers or children who are still in school. Apart from enjoying the beauty of nature and playing in the water, students can also learn about the biota, ecosystem, and landscape in Bunaken. Even a mangrove tree planting program can be observed how it can be a good experience for school children. There are also coral transplants that are no less exciting to see.

- Watch Dolphins and Whales
You should know! There is a natural habitat for dolphins and whales in the Bunaken Sea. To witness it, you can rent a boat to see the marine animals up close. If you are lucky, you can see dolphins performing at attractions such as jumping. It must have been great to see dolphins and whales up close.
